Soba Noodles with Sunbutter Sauce

Serve this dish chilled or warm and get ready for love at first bite!

  • Prep: 15 mins
  • Cook: 35 mins

Ingredients

Noodles

1 8-ounce package of soba noodles

⅓ cup cilantro leaves, chopped

1 red pepper, finely diced

1 carrot julienned

2 scallions, sliced

1-2 tablespoons toasted sesame seeds for garnish

Sauce

2 tablespoons peanut oil

2 garlic cloves, minced

1 small hot chili pepper, minced

2 kaffir lime leaves (or 1 teaspoon of lime zest)

1 lemongrass stalk, trimmed and minced

2 shallots, minced

¾ cup coconut milk

2 tablespoons date sugar

½ cup creamy sunbutter

½ teaspoon kosher or sea salt

½ cup of water (or more if needed)

Directions

1In a medium saucepan, cook soba noodles according to package directions. Prepare cilantro, red pepper, carrot, scallions, and sesame seeds and set aside.

2In a separate small saucepan, heat oil over a medium-high flame. Add the garlic, chili, Kaffir lime leaves, lemongrass, and shallots, and cook for several minutes while stirring.

3Add the coconut milk, date sugar, sunflower seed butter, salt, and water.

4Stir to blend well and bring to a boil.

5Lower the heat to medium-low and cook for 20 minutes, uncovered, stirring once in awhile to prevent sticking.

6The sauce should have reduced and should be thick enough to coat the back of a spoon. If you need to cook longer, go ahead!

7Keep warm until ready to serve;discard the Kaffir lime leaves.

8Drain noodles and place in a large mixing bowl. Add only half the sauce and toss well.

9Add more sauce as needed.

10Fold in cilantro, red pepper, carrots, and scallions.

11Sprinkle with sesame seeds. Serve warm or room temperature.

FAB Tips: I love using sunflower butter instead of peanut butter and I usually just pick up a couple bottles at my local Trader Joes.
